Abstract
Following the seminal success of the H.264/MPEG-4 advanced video coding (AVC) and its significant commercial impact on the IT industry, ISO/IEC SC29/WG11 (MPEG) and ITU-T SG16/Q6 (VCEG) began working together to develop the next generation video coding standard. This emerging standard, known as HEVC, is capable of providing a significantly higher coding performance and with greater flexibility than H.264/AVC. The expectation is that it will be more widely adopted by the industry than any of its predecessors.
